The 2018 Akron Zips football team represents the University of Akron in the 2018 NCAA Division I FBS football season. They are led by seventh-year head coach Terry Bowden and play their home games at InfoCision Stadium–Summa Field in Akron, Ohio as members of the East Division of the Mid-American Conference.
Previous season
The Zips finished the 2017 season 7–7, 6–2 in MAC play to win the East Division. They lost to Toledo in the MAC Championship. They received an invitation to play in the Boca Raton Bowl where they lost to Florida Atlantic.

Preseason media poll
The MAC released their preseason media poll on July 24, 2018, with the Zips predicted to finish in fourth place in the East Division.[5]
